Spain’s procurador is a unique legal figure, often misunderstood even by locals. Unlike an abogado (lawyer) who argues the law or a graduado social who handles labor matters, the procurador is the court’s logistical backbone. They represent the parties in a procedural sense: receiving notifications, filing appeals, meeting deadlines, and ensuring the judicial machinery doesn’t grind to a halt. In Pontevedra, a provincial capital with a bustling judiciary but a small-town rhythm, this role becomes deeply personal. procurador en pontevedra

Why? Because Pontevedra’s courts — from the Audiencia Provincial to the Juzgados de Primera Instancia — operate on relationships and local nuance. A procurador who has spent twenty years shuttling documents between the same courthouse on Avenida Augusto García Sánchez knows exactly which clerk opens mail at 9:03 AM, which judge signs off on appeals faster on Wednesdays, and which notary in the province is prone to summer delays.
